The New England Council on Crime and Delinquency would like to congratulate the following recipients of the 2008 Bruce Campbell Scholarship:

Stephanie Anderson (CT) – Stephanie is a freshman at the University of Rhode Island, majoring in Environmental Science.  After graduation, she hopes to attend their Oceanographic Graduate School.  Stephanie has been active in field hockey, track & field, tennis, Art Honor Society, the newspaper and volunteers for Girl Scouts and her church.


David DelFino (RI) – David is entering his freshman year at the Community College of Rhode Island, pursuing a degree in physical education.  David has been a camp counselor for the past two summers and has been involved in Student Council, a leadership club, soccer, basketball, baseball and volleyball.


Richard DelFino, III (RI) – Richard is entering his senior year at Providence College majoring in history with a minor in Political Science and is pursuing a law degree. Richard has been a part of the Ambassador Club, National and RI Honor Societies, Foreign Language Honor Society and baseball.


Andrew Lattarulo (MA) – Andrew is a freshman at the University of Rhode Island, majoring in International Business.  Andrew is fluent in English, Spanish and French and is active in the Peruvian American Community, his church, a local nursing home community services, and has been a COPEA volunteer ESL teacher.


Michaela Morgan (RI) – Michaela is a sophomore at Keene State, majoring in Communications with minor in Sociology.  In high school, Michaela was active in Student Government, cross country and track.  She is currently participating in a Living and Learning Community Program at Keene State.


Stephen Wallace (MA) – Stephen is a sophomore at Nichols College, working towards his bachelor’s degree in Criminal Justice Management.  He hopes to pursue a Masters Degree and work for the FBI.  During high school, Stephen was active in volunteer work, varsity sports including soccer, track and basketball and was part of the National Honor Society.


Brittany Worcester (ME) – Brittany is entering her freshman year at Saint Joseph’s College, majoring in Biology with a concentration in the Pre-Physician’s Assistant Program.  Throughout high school, Brittany was involved in band, chorus and drama and has volunteered coaching many youth sports programs, including t-ball, softball, soccer and basketball.
